NTC To Host Agricultural Seminar Series
 
(Wausau, WI) – Northcentral Technical College (NTC), in conjunction with the Partnership for Progressive Agriculture and Marathon County UW-Extension, will host a four-part Agricultural Seminar Series at its Wausau campus, with the aim of educating current farming professionals on key planning issues related to their business.
 
The series will open with a Grain Outlook Seminar that will be held from 12:00 p.m.-3:00 p.m. on Friday, Dec. 16. The seminar will cover the current state of the grain market and where it is headed in the future. Topics of discussion will also include the 2011 harvest results, current corn and soybean prices, planting intentions and price outlook for 2012. In addition, the seminar will contain a review of the local market results and trends, along with an update on the ethanol industry and how proposed changes in ethanol subsidies may impact the market.
 
Featured speakers at the Grain Outlook Seminar will include David Moll, Grain Marketing Outlook Specialist for the UW-Extension Department of Agricultural & Applied Economics, Randy Riehle from Wisconsin Rapids Grain, LLC and Roland Koenig, Commodities Manager for Marquis Energy-Wisconsin, LLC.
 
The cost for the Grain Outlook Seminar is $16 for PPA members and $20 for non-PPA members. Lunch will be provided.
 
NTC will also host upcoming seminars on Farm Succession Planning (Jan. 24), Ag Land Values (Feb. 29) and Creating a Safe Farm Working Environment (March 23) as part of the series.
